What affects the price

The final price for your bathroom project depends on a few specific things. First, the size of your space and the layout changes you want matter. If we are moving plumbing lines or electrical outlets, that adds labor time compared to a simple swap. Your choice of materials—like tile type, custom vanities, or premium shower hardware—also shifts the total. We focus on your specific needs to ensure you don't overpay for things you don't want. About this service

The cost of adding a bathroom is higher than a standard remodel because it often requires creating new plumbing lines, ventilation, and electrical circuits in a space that wasn't designed for them. You might need this if your growing household needs more utility.

What are good bathroom floor tiles?

Good bathroom floor tiles are durable, water-resistant, and offer good traction. Porcelain and ceramic tiles are excellent choices due to their longevity and wide range of styles. Luxury vinyl plank (LVP) is also a popular, practical option that mimics wood or stone. Ensure the chosen tiles can withstand moisture and frequent use.

What type of bathroom wall tile is best?

The best type of bathroom wall tile depends on its location and your aesthetic preferences. For shower areas, porcelain or ceramic tiles with low water absorption are ideal. Larger format tiles can minimize grout lines for easier cleaning. Consider the durability and maintenance requirements of different materials. A pro can guide your selection.
